深入理解 Jade 中的 A 标签324


前言

Jade 是一种流行的模板引擎,用于生成 HTML 和 XML 文档。它以其简洁和可读性而闻名,使其成为开发人员构建动态 Web 应用程序的理想选择。

Jade 中的 A 标签

A 标签在 Jade 中用于创建超链接。它具有以下语法:```
a(href, title, name, target, rel) content
```
* href: 超链接的目标 URL。
* title: 超链接的标题。
* name: 超链接的名称。
* target: 超链接的目标框架或窗口。
* rel: 超链接与当前文档的关系。
* content: 超链接的文本或 HTML 内容。

Jade 中 A 标签的属性

除了上述属性外,Jade 中的 A 标签还支持以下属性:* class: 为链接添加 CSS 类。
* id: 为链接添加一个 ID。
* style: 为链接设置内联样式。
* accesskey: 为链接指定一个访问键。
* tabindex: 定义键盘焦点在页面上的顺序。
* download: 指定是否将链接的目标下载到用户的计算机。
* media: 指定链接适用的媒体类型。

Jade 中 A 标签的示例

以下是一些在 Jade 中使用 A 标签的示例:```
// 创建一个到 Google 首页的链接
a(href="") Google
// 创建一个带有标题的链接
a(href="", title="Example Website") Example Website
// 创建一个带有目标的链接
a(href="", target="_blank") Example Website (new tab)
// 创建一个带有 rel 的链接
a(href="", rel="nofollow") Example Website
```

Jade 中 A 标签的最佳实践

以下是使用 Jade 中 A 标签的一些最佳实践:* 始终为链接指定 href 属性。 href 属性是必填的,因为它指定链接的目标。
* 使用 title 属性提供链接的描述性标题。 title 属性提供有关链接的附加信息,对于辅助功能和搜索引擎优化 (SEO) 至关重要。
* 使用 target 属性在新选项卡或窗口中打开链接。 target 属性允许您控制链接目标的打开方式。
* 使用 rel 属性定义链接与当前文档的关系。 rel 属性可以指示链接是 nofollow、external 或 canonical。
* 确保链接文本具有描述性。 链接文本应清楚地表明链接的目标。
* 避免使用 JavaScript 打开链接。 使用 JavaScript 打开链接会导致 SEO 问题,并且可能会导致页面加载速度变慢。

Jade 中的 A 标签是一个强大的工具,用于构建动态和可交互的 Web 应用程序。通过理解 A 标签的语法、属性和最佳实践,您可以有效地创建超链接,提升用户体验和 SEO。

2024-11-24


上一篇:揭秘外链节:高质量外链的完整指南

下一篇:移动 SEO 优化定价:深入指南